Transaction 3bb62abe2a352643d49de5effc51196e0a04a1e0da28b99f0f846be68fdacac9
1 Input
1 Output
-
3bb62abe2a352643d49de5effc51196e0a04a1e0da28b99f0f846be68fdacac9:0
- value
- 46898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9cded1846134298ec0adc05abf384393555b2338 OP_EQUAL
- address
- 3FzUGAXCAi2JbW3R6A1bFneBV57H6cwqdj